The lubricant specified for the 2017 Toyota Tacoma is crucial for maintaining engine health and performance. This fluid, typically a synthetic blend or full synthetic conforming to API standards, serves to reduce friction between moving engine parts, dissipate heat, and suspend contaminants. The precise viscosity grade recommended, often 0W-20 or 5W-30, depends on factors such as operating climate and driving conditions, and is typically outlined in the vehicle’s owner’s manual.

Proper lubrication offers several key benefits. It extends engine lifespan by minimizing wear and tear, improves fuel economy by reducing internal resistance, and helps prevent the build-up of sludge and deposits that can impair engine function. Historically, manufacturers have increasingly shifted towards lighter viscosity synthetic oils to meet stricter fuel efficiency standards and to provide enhanced protection across a wider range of temperatures. Adherence to the manufacturer’s recommended service intervals and fluid specifications is paramount in preserving the vehicle’s powertrain warranty and ensuring optimal operation.

The component affixed to the front and rear of a 2017 mid-size pickup truck from a specific Japanese manufacturer is designed primarily to absorb impact during a collision, mitigating damage to the vehicle’s body and potentially reducing injury to occupants. It is typically constructed of steel, aluminum, or reinforced plastic, and its design integrates with the vehicle’s overall aesthetic. The specific iteration for this model year aligns with the third generation of this truck, produced from 2016 to 2023.

This protective element plays a crucial role in vehicle safety, complying with federal regulations concerning low-speed impact resistance. Beyond its protective function, it can contribute to the vehicle’s appearance, with aftermarket options offering enhanced styling and functionality, such as integrated lighting or winch mounts. The design evolved from purely functional metal bars to more complex, aesthetically integrated structures, reflecting changing safety standards and consumer preferences.
